Comprehensive Guide to Residential Window Installation

Residential window installation is a significant consideration for house owners seeking to improve the performance and visual appeals of their residential or commercial properties. Windows play a vital role in energy performance, security, and convenience and can drastically affect the general value of a home. Whether installing new windows in a recently built home or changing old windows in an existing residence, comprehending the procedure can ensure that the installation is completed efficiently and effectively.

Benefits of Residential Window Installation

Before diving into the installation process, it is beneficial to understand the various advantages brand-new window installations provide:

  1. Increased Energy Efficiency: Modern windows are designed to provide much better insulation, leading to decreased heating & cooling costs.
  2. Improved Aesthetics: New windows can improve the curb appeal of a home, making it more appealing to prospective buyers.
  3. Boosted Security: Updated windows frequently feature much better locking systems and sturdier products, enhancing home security.
  4. Noise Reduction: Newer Top-Rated Window Installer styles can help lessen outdoor sound, developing a more tranquil indoor environment.
  5. UV Protection: Modern windows typically include finishings that secure furnishings and floor covering from hazardous ultraviolet (UV) rays.

Kinds Of Residential Windows

There are numerous types of residential windows available, each offering special benefits. Below is a detailed list of common window designs:

  • Double-Hung Windows: Feature two vertically moving sashes, allowing for ventilation from the top or bottom.
  • Casement Window Installation Company Windows: Hinged on the side and open external, supplying outstanding ventilation.
  • Slider Windows: Operate horizontally and are easy to open, making them appropriate for larger openings.
  • Awning Windows: Hinged on top and open external, using ventilation even throughout rain.
  • Bay and Bow Windows: Project outward from the home, producing additional interior space and breathtaking views.
  • Picture Windows: Large, set windows that do closed, perfect for catching views.

The Installation Process

Installing windows can be a complex task needing careful preparation and execution. Here is a step-by-step introduction of the installation process:

1. Planning and Measurements

  • Select Window Style: Choose the window type based upon your requirements, looks, and spending plan.
  • Step Window Openings: Accurate measurements are essential for making sure a correct fit. A professional installer often takes this step to avoid mistakes.

2. Removal of Old Windows

  • Prepare the Area: Clear any furniture or obstacles near the window's installation website.
  • Mindful Removal: Safely get rid of old windows, making sure not to harm surrounding structures.

3. Installation of New Windows

  • Place the New Window: Place the new Certified Window Installer into the opening and guarantee it is level.
  • Secure it: Fasten the window frame utilizing screws or nails, following manufacturer standards.
  • Insulate: Add insulation to close spaces around the window frame to prevent drafts.
  • Seal: Apply caulking to develop a waterproof seal between the window and the frame.

4. Completing Touches

  • Set up Trim: Add window housing or cut for visual appeals.
  • Final Inspection: Check for any gaps, leaks, or positioning concerns.
  • Tidy up: Remove any debris and clean the brand-new Window Installation Service Near Me.

5. Post-Installation Care

Following installation, homeowners should follow simple upkeep ideas to maximize the longevity of their new windows. Regular cleansing, examination for damage, and timely caulking will help keep performance and aesthetic appeals.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. How long does window installation take?

The time required for window installation can differ based upon the variety of windows being set up and the intricacy of the project. Typically, it can take anywhere from a few hours to a number of days.

2. Do I need a license for window installation?

In lots of areas, an authorization is required for window installation, especially if the job includes structural changes. It's suggested to check local guidelines.

3. How do I understand if I need to change my windows?

Signs that may suggest the need for replacement consist of drafts, difficulty opening or closing the windows, broken or decomposing frames, and high energy bills.

4. What should I expect during the installation procedure?

Homeowners can expect some sound and disruption throughout the installation procedure. However, Professional Window Installer installers normally intend to lessen hassle.

5. Can I set up windows myself?

While DIY installation is possible, employing a professional is suggested for appropriate fitting, insulation, and sealing, especially given the financial investment involved.
